Xaml问题(我猜)

时间:2014-06-16 22:12:05

标签: c# xaml windows-runtime winrt-xaml windows-phone-8.1

我正在为我的学校开发Windows Phone 8.1(WinRT)项目,而我正在尝试做的事情非常简单。我只想尝试使用以下方式打开新页面:

    private void Button_Click(object sender, RoutedEventArgs e)
    {
        Frame.Navigate(typeof(Page2));
    }

问题是如果我在Button Click事件上使用该代码,代码总是有效..但如果我使用与MenuFlyoutItem Click事件完全相同的代码:

    private void MenuFlyoutItem_Click(object sender, RoutedEventArgs e)
    {
         Frame.Navigate(typeof(Page2));
    }

App Crash。此时打开App.g.i.cs标签。

#if DEBUG && !DISABLE_XAML_GENERATED_BREAK_ON_UNHANDLED_EXCEPTION
        UnhandledException += (sender, e) =>
        {
            if (global::System.Diagnostics.Debugger.IsAttached)        global::System.Diagnostics.Debugger.Break();
        };
#endif

如果之前已经提出这个问题,我很抱歉,但我在网上找不到任何内容。

提前感谢您的帮助。

0 个答案:

没有答案